The festival has been developed in response to the rapid rise in women's and girls rugby in England. According to the RFU, 40,000 women and girls are now registered as players, with this figure growing at 17% per year, which is astounding. Recent news of TikTok sponsoring the Women’s Six Nations has elevated growth, and we are seeing more mainstream media coverage of the sport.
London Irish Amateur’s celebration of girls rugby will attract teams from the UK and overseas, with a league format for U12 to U18 age groups. The event has been organised to coincide with the milestone Red Roses vs. France match at Twickenham and the bank holiday. Youth Girls rugby at London Irish Amateur is inclusive and competitive and we run age group teams at U12, U14, U16 and U18. Our coaching offers opportunity for girls who are new to the sport and those seeking a platform for player progression and advancement. Several of our girls are currently playing in the England Rugby DPP and at County level. We promote enjoyment and camaraderie and develop our players to be the best version of themselves. We train on Wednesday and Thursday evenings, and on Sunday mornings.
